Hawks Edge Mustang, 10-9
|
The Boise Hawks topped the Carson City Mustang, 10-9, with youngster Rogelio Ros playing a key role. Ros went 2 for 3 with 2 singles and 3 walks. He scored 2 times for the Hawks in the win. Anton Ayala, now 6-9, was credited with the win in 2.1 innings of relief. He allowed 1 run on 2 hits, while striking out 2 and walking 1. Earning his 11th save for Boise was Jim Kellar.
Boise designated hitter Nick Sander contributed a timely at-bat in the top of the first. With two down, he hit a changeup to center field for a 2-run single. It was his 13th hit of the season and put the Hawks ahead, 3-0.
"Nervous? No," said Sander. "It was my time to shine."
Despite the win, the Hawks have a lousy 30-78 record.
